Chinese 101A -101B - Advanced Readings in Modern Chinese

Institution:
University of California-Los Angeles
Subject:
Description:
Lecture, two hours; discussion, two hours. Enforced requisite: course 100C or 100I or Chinese placement test. Not open to students who have learned, from whatever source, enough Chinese to qualify for more advanced courses. Advanced readings and discussion for students planning to do advanced coursework or research on China. Topics from magazines, journals, and books related to humanities and social sciences. Each course may be taken independently for credit. Letter grading.
